Honeytrap case: Ahmedabad Crime Branch arrest PSI Brahmbhatt

Ahmedabad: City Police Crime Branch has arrested a Police Sub Inspector Janak Brahmbhatt in honey trap case. Janak is 8th person arrested in this case. He was wanted and on run. Police has earlier arrested then Inspector of Mahila Police Station Mrs. Geeta Pathan and head constable Shardaben Khant among others. Janak was serving as Sub Inspector in Mahila Police Station.

Then inspector Geeta Pathan had allegedly helped a gang in extorting Rs 26.55 lakh from at least five traders by threatening to implicate them in fake rape cases. Pathan allegedly took half the money from the gang and also gave some share to her juniors who helped her intimidate the victims and pressure them into giving money to the gang members to settle the issue. In February, a victim had submitted an application to the crime branch, alleging that a gang with some women members had befriended him through Facebook then extorted money from him by threatening to entrap him in a false rape case. Later, officials received four more such applications.
In March, the crime branch arrested four persons, including two 19-year olds, on charges of extortion and criminal conspiracy. The gang members would trap traders using fake Facebook IDs of girls after which the female members would invite them to a hotel or a secluded place. Later, the gang would submit an application against the victims at the woman police station headed by Pathan.

On the pretext of recording their statements, Pathan would call the victims to the police station and pressure them to “settle” the matter with applicants, the statement added. Pathan and her staffers would threaten the victims, saying they may get arrested in a rape case if they did not arrive at a compromise formula with the applicant.
